The Witcher 3 Has suddenly begun lagging
So this recent Windows 10 update made all my other games lag as if my hardware was on fire. Before the update happend, everything ran like a knife through butter. And this annoyed me,so i unistalled Win10 and reinstalled Win7 64, The installation went perfect. Thanksfully i was able to figure out why that was the case (game settings) However, despite all my technical effort, The Witcher 3 still keeps on lagging. I remember disabling GOG overlay which i believe to have caused the game to missing the intro and going straight to the main menu. Reinstalling The Witcher 3 hasn't changed anything. The menu and the loading screen runs perfect. Once it is about to load the ingame it will start to slow down. Like i said there were no performance problem with The Witcher 3 prior to the update. I played it at 60 fps with a mix of medium-high stettings. Now it's not really "lagging" it is more like as if the game is drunk and slow like slowmotion. Since Reinstalling doesn't work will i have to rebuy The Witcher 3? This update must have changed something. Perhaps an unkown setting? Missing driver? Registry? Should i reinstall Win10?
Here's what i have tried;
-Changing the graphic options to no avail
-Changing the 3D options in Nvidia Control Panel
-Changing the user.stettings
-Deleting user.bak
-Verify/Repair
-Reinstalled Witcher 3 multiple times
-Reinstalled two different nvidia drivers in safemode (August and latest)
-Unistalling/Reinstalling Graphic Card Driver at device manager in safemode
-Set it to run Witcher 3 in high priority
-Set it to run Witcher 3 in Win7 compatibility
-Set The Witcher 3 to run with dedicated graphic card
-Enabled/Disable CPU cores usage
